What can I see and do near Hohes Schloss?
Study the collections at Museum of Fuessen, Museum of the History of Wittelsbach or Museum der Bayerischen Könige. St. Mang's Abbey, Hohenschwangau Castle and Falkenstein Castle are notable landmarks to explore if you're in the area. Attractions like Fuessen Music Hall and Museum of the Bavarian Kings highlight the local culture.
